How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 20026?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 20026 Studio Apartments | $2,204 | $769 | $14,970 |
| 20026 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,865 | $769 | $14,548 |
| 20026 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,246 | $990 | $25,164 |
| 20026 3 Bedroom Apartments | $6,181 | $1,335 | $29,274 |
| 20026 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,824 | $1,281 | $13,241 |
| 20026 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,919 | $1,414 | $5,800 |
| 20026 6 Bedroom Apartments | $5,500 | $5,500 | $5,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 20026 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 20026?
There are currently 1,255 Studio Apartments in 20026 with rent ranges from $769 to $14,970 with an average price of $2,204.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 20026 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 20026 ranges from $769 to $14,548 with an average monthly rent of $2,865.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 20026 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 20026 range from $990 to $25,164.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,246.
How expensive are 20026 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 287 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 20026 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,335 to $29,274 - averaging $6,181 for the location.
